Most states established a criterion of "preponderance of the evidence" with regard to competency. In other words, a defendant had to show that it was more likely than not that he or she was incompetent.
Corruption
The misuse of government power, with which one has been entrusted or assigned, to obtain private gain; includes payments from individuals or companies to secure advantages in obtaining government contracts, avoiding government regulations, or obtaining inside knowledge about forthcoming policy changes.
